< 創世記 19 >

1 其二個の天使黄昏にソドムに至るロト時にソドムの門に坐し居たりしがこれを視起て迎へ首を地にさげて
And the two Angels arrived at Sodom in the evening, and Lot was sitting at the gate of the city. And when he had seen them, he rose up and went to meet them. And he reverenced prone on the ground.
2 言けるは我主よ請ふ僕の家に臨み足を濯ひて宿りつとに起きて途に遄征たまへ彼等言ふ否我等は街衢に宿らんと
And he said: “I beg you, my lords, turn aside to the house of your servant, and lodge there. Wash your feet, and in the morning you will advance on your way.” And they said, “Not at all. But we will lodge in the street.”
3 然ど固く強ければ遂に彼の所に臨みて其家に入るロト乃ち彼等のために筵を設け酵いれぬパンを炊て食はしめたり
He pressed them very much to turn aside to him. And when they had entered his house, he made a feast for them, and he cooked unleavened bread, and they ate.
4 斯て未だ寢ざる前に邑の人々即ちソドムの人老たるも若きも諸共に四方八方より來たれる民皆其家を環み
But before they went to bed, the men of the city surrounded the house, from boys to old men, all the people together.
5 ロトを呼て之に言けるは今夕爾に就たる人は何處にをるや彼等を我等の所に携へ出せ我等之を知らん
And they called out to Lot, and they said to him: “Where are the men who entered to you in the night? Bring them out here, so that we may know them.”
6 ロト入口に出て其後の戸を閉ぢ彼等の所に至りて
Lot went out to them, and blocking the door behind him, he said:
7 言けるは請ふ兄弟よ惡き事を爲すなかれ
“Do not, I ask you, my brothers, do not be willing to commit this evil.
8 我に未だ男知ぬ二人の女あり請ふ我之を携へ出ん爾等の目に善と見ゆる如く之になせよ唯此人等は既に我家の蔭に入たれば何をも之になすなかれ
I have two daughters who as yet have not known man. I will bring them out to you; abuse them as it pleases you, provided that you do no evil to these men, because they have entered under the shadow of my roof.”
9 彼等曰ふ爾退け又言けるは此人は來り寓れる身なるに恒に士師とならんとす然ば我等彼等に加ふるよりも多くの害を爾に加へんと遂に彼等酷しく其人ロトに逼り前よりて其戸を破んとせしに
But they said, “Move away from there.” And again: “You have entered,” they said, “as a stranger; should you then judge? Therefore, we will afflict you yourself more than them.” And they acted very violently against Lot. And they were now at the point of breaking open the doors.
10 彼二人其手を舒しロトを家の内に援いれて其戸を閉ぢ
And behold, the men put out their hand, and they pulled Lot in to them, and they closed the door.
11 家の入口にをる人衆をして大なるも小も倶に目を眩しめければ彼等遂に入口を索ぬるに困憊たり
And they struck those who were outside with blindness, from the least to the greatest, so that they were not able to find the door.
12 斯て二人ロトに言けるは外に爾に屬する者ありや汝の婿子女および凡て邑にをりて爾に屬する者を此所より携へ出べし
Then they said to Lot: “Do you have here anyone of yours? All who are yours, sons-in-law, or sons, or daughters, bring them out of this city.
13 此處の號呼ヱホバの前に大になりたるに因て我等之を滅さんとすヱホバ我等を遣はして之を滅さしめたまふ
For we will eliminate this place, because the outcry among them has increased before the Lord, who sent us to destroy them.”
14 ロト出て其女を娶る婿等に告て言けるはヱホバが邑を滅したまふべければ爾等起て此處を出よと然ど婿等は之を戲言と視爲り
And so Lot, going out, spoke to his sons-in-law, who were going to receive his daughters, and he said: “Rise up. Depart from this place. For the Lord will destroy this city.” And it seemed to them that he was speaking playfully.
15 曉に及て天使ロトを促して言けるは起て此なる爾の妻と二人の女を携へよ恐くは爾邑の惡とともに滅されん
And when it was morning, the Angels compelled him, saying, “Arise, take your wife, and the two daughters that you have, lest you also should perish amid the wickedness of the city.”
16 然るに彼遲延ひしかば二人其手と其妻の手と其二人の女の手を執て之を導き出し邑の外に置りヱホバ斯彼に仁慈を加へたまふ
And, since he ignored them, they took his hand, and the hand of his wife, as well as that of his two daughters, because the Lord was sparing him.
17 既に之を導き出して其一人曰けるは逃遁て汝の生命を救へ後を回顧るなかれ低地の中に止るなかれ山に遁れよ否ずば爾滅されん
And they brought him out, and placed him beyond the city. And there they spoke to him, saying: “Save your life. Do not look back. Neither should you stay in the entire surrounding region. But save yourself in the mountain, lest you also should perish.”
18 ロト彼等に言けるはわが主よ請ふ斯したまふなかれ
And Lot said to them: “I beg you, my lord,
19 視よ僕爾の目のまへに恩を得たり爾大なる仁慈を吾に施してわが生命を救たまふ吾山に遁る能はず恐くは災害身に及びて死るにいたらん
though your servant has found grace before you, and you have magnified your mercy, which you have shown to me in saving my life, I cannot be saved on the mountain, lest perhaps some misfortune take hold of me and I die.
20 視よ此邑は遁ゆくに近くして且小し我をして彼處に遁れしめよしからば吾生命全からん是は小き邑なるにあらずや
There is a certain city nearby, to which I can flee; it is a little one, and I will be saved in it. Is it not a modest one, and will not my soul live?”
21 天使之にいひけるは視よ我此事に關ても亦爾の願を容たれば爾が言ふところの邑を滅さじ
And he said to him: “Behold, even now, I have heard your petitions about this, not to overturn the city on behalf of which you have spoken.
22 急ぎて彼處に遁れよ爾が彼處に至るまでは我何事をも爲を得ずと是に因て其邑の名はゾアル(小し)と稱る
Hurry and be saved there. For I cannot do anything until you enter there.” For this reason, the name of that city is called Zoar.
23 ロト、ゾアルに至れる時日地の上に昇れり
The sun had risen over the land, and Lot had entered into Zoar.
24 ヱホバ硫黄と火をヱホバの所より即ち天よりソドムとゴモラに雨しめ
Therefore, the Lord rained upon Sodom and Gomorrah sulphur and fire, from the Lord, out of heaven.
25 其邑と低地と其邑の居民および地に生るところの物を盡く滅したまへり
And he overturned these cities, and all the surrounding region: all the inhabitants of the cities, and everything that springs from the land.
26 ロトの妻は後を回顧たれば鹽の柱となりぬ
And his wife, looking behind herself, was turned into a statue of salt.
27 アブラハム其朝夙に起て其嘗てヱホバの前に立たる處に至り
Then Abraham, rising up in the morning, in the place where he had stood before with the Lord,
28 ソドム、ゴモラおよび低地の全面を望み見るに其地の烟燄窰の烟のごとくに騰上れり
looked out toward Sodom and Gomorrah, and the entire land of that region. And he saw embers rising up from the land like smoke from a furnace.
29 神低地の邑を滅したまふ時即ちロトの住る邑を滅したまふ時に當り神アブラハムを眷念て斯其滅亡の中よりロトを出したまへり
For when God overthrew the cities of that region, remembering Abraham, he freed Lot from the overthrow of the cities, in which he had dwelt.
30 斯てロト、ゾアルに居ることを懼れたれば其二人の女と偕にゾアルを出て上りて山に居り其二人の女子とともに巖穴に住り
And Lot ascended from Zoar, and he stayed on the mountain, and likewise his two daughters with him, (for he was afraid to stay in Zoar) and he dwelt in a cave, he and his two daughters with him.
31 茲に長女季女にいひけるは我等の父は老いたり又此地には我等に偶て世の道を成す人あらず
And the elder said to the younger: “Our father is old, and no man remains in the land who can enter to us according to the custom of the whole world.
32 然ば我等父に酒を飮せて與に寢ね父に由て子を得んと
Come, let us inebriate him with wine, and let us sleep with him, so that we may be able to preserve offspring from our father.”
33 遂に其夜父に酒を飮せ長女入て其父と與に寢たり然るにロトは女の起臥を知ざりき
And so they gave their father wine to drink that night. And the elder went in, and she slept with her father. But he did not perceive it, neither when his daughter lay down, nor when she rose up.
34 翌日長女季女に言けるは我昨夜わが父と寢たり我等此夜又父に酒をのません爾入て與に寢よわれらの父に由て子を得ることをえんと
Likewise, the next day, the elder said to the younger: “Behold, yesterday I slept with my father, let us give him wine to drink yet again this night, and you will sleep with him, so that we may save offspring from our father.”
35 乃ち其夜も亦父に酒をのませ季女起て父と與に寢たりロトまた女の起臥を知ざりき
And then they gave their father wine to drink that night also, and the younger daughter went in, and slept with him. And not even then did he perceive when she lay down, or when she rose up.
36 斯ロトの二人の女其父によりて孕みたり
Therefore, the two daughters of Lot conceived by their father.
37 長女子を生み其名をモアブと名く即ち今のモアブ人の先祖なり
And the elder gave birth to a son, and she called his name Moab. He is the father of the Moabites, even to the present day.
38 季女も亦子を生み其名をベニアンミと名く即ち今のアンモニ人の先祖なり
Likewise, the younger gave birth to a son, and she called his name Ammon, that is, ‘the son of my people.’ He is the father of the Ammonites, even today.
